# SpaceX's Trillion-Dollar Bet on AI That Doesn't Exist Yet SpaceX is asking investors for roughly $75-80 billion by claiming its satellite business will become hugely valuable to AI companies, even though it currently makes almost no money from AI. The company's actual profitable business—Starlink internet—is solid, but SpaceX is gambling that future AI demand will justify a valuation nearly 100 times higher than its current earnings, which is a risky bet on technology that may never materialize as promised.
